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

WCAG: 2.1 Keyboard Accessible #4128

Closed
StephDriver opened this issue Apr 29, 2024 · 0 comments
Closed

WCAG: 2.1 Keyboard Accessible #4128

StephDriver opened this issue Apr 29, 2024 · 0 comments
Assignees
Labels
a11y Issues that relate to acessibility audit an inspection or deliberately search for issues.

Comments

@StephDriver
Copy link
Contributor

StephDriver commented Apr 29, 2024

Requirement

https://www.w3.org/TR/WCAG22/#keyboard-accessible

Make all functionality available from a keyboard.

Current Situation

✅ : Keyboard

There is no functionality which requires specific timings for individual keystrokes. All functionality is designed to be operable through a keyboard interface.

❌ No Keyboard Trap

This audit identified a few bugs where once keyboard focus was moved to some components they could not be dismissed by the keyboard. These were found when testing with a screenreader and braille keyboard (#4194) and affect the navigation menu and popups.

✅ Character Key Shortcuts

There are no custom keyboard shortcuts.

Work to do

No Keyboard Trap

@StephDriver StephDriver added a11y Issues that relate to acessibility audit an inspection or deliberately search for issues. labels Apr 29, 2024
@StephDriver StephDriver self-assigned this Apr 29, 2024
@StephDriver StephDriver moved this to In Progress in Accessibility May 14, 2024
@StephDriver StephDriver moved this from In Progress to Scheduled in Accessibility May 14, 2024
@StephDriver StephDriver moved this from Scheduled to In Progress in Accessibility Jun 4, 2024
@StephDriver StephDriver moved this from In Progress to Done in Accessibility Jun 10,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
a11y Issues that relate to acessibility audit an inspection or deliberately search for issues.
Projects
Status: Done
Development

No branches or pull requests

1 participant